Overall Experience Here: 4.0
Playing here is almost like playing in a home game. The whole atmosphere is pretty friendly and nothing is ostentatious like what you might find at other poker rooms. We also like a service they provide here of phoning you on your cell phone when your turn is up. This is most convenient if you are driving in or you miss them paging you.
Soft Competition Rating: 4.0
We like a high soft competition rating when you have alot of players calling every hand. It makes for a table where there are many who are bound to make mistakes, since they are in the hand.
We found a high amount of callers here, at least 5 to see the flop; especially the tourists that sat at the tables. You will usually find tourists tend to call more often here than the locals. The locals will play tighter since they usually play on a regular basis.
Room Condition: 2.5
The room is practical and comfortable. They have swivel chairs which makes for easier sitting down and getting up out of the tables. We also liked the fact that the room was very close to the washrooms, so you could take a quick break and come back without missing too much.
Aggressiveness Rating: 4.0
We noticed the tourists liked to call quite a bit. So if someone raised, it was most likely going to be called. This leads to bigger pots, more player mistakes, and a money market for skilled players. However, at the same time, you'll also get more bad beats with players simply paying cards they had no business playing after calling your raise.
Player Mix: 5.0
At this poker room, you'll find an equal mix of tourists and locals playing at the tables. If there were 3 or 4 callers at the table, only 1 would be a local, the rest would be tourists.
Dealer Rating: 3.5
We found the Dealer's here to be cheerful and nice. They dealt the hands with not much mishap, and with the occasional misdeal. Games moved along at a good pace and we felt the Dealer's had the tables under control.
Cocktail Service: 2.5
Cocktail service here was pretty average. The waitresses were not spectacular but were okay. You didn't have to wait too long after your order to receive your drink, but they can be a bit quicker. They also responded to you pleasantly and weren't rude. Some of the older poker rooms we have found some of the waitresses are tired and don't have the energy to keep up a pleasant pretence. The waitresses at Palms are fine.
Management Rating: 4.0
Management served you well enough here and even will call your cell phone to tell you your turn is up. That's a pretty efficient service which we think many of the poker rooms should incorporate.
Comps: 3.5
$1/hour playing here to a maximum of $10.
Weekly draw for $100 for diamond flushes.
Make sure you ask them what their weekly jackpots are, they offer different ones all the time and you have to ask or you won't know about them.
